What is the climate like in St George?

St George has a hot semi‑arid climate with very hot summers (average highs around 35 °C) and mild winters (averages near 20 °C), and it receives low annual rainfall of roughly 480 mm

How many people live in St George?

At the 2021 census the town’s population was recorded at 3,130 residents

Are there any nature reserves or wildlife areas nearby?

Yes, the Powrunna State Forest and the Richard Underwood Nature Refuge are both close to town and support unique wildlife, including endangered wombats

What local events might residents enjoy?

The annual St George Show during the Labour Day long weekend is a popular community event, and the Balonne River offers excellent fishing for species such as yellowbelly and Murray cod
